🇫🇷 Rallye Charlemagne – France 🇫🇷

Last weekend, we headed to France for Rallye Charlemagne – a new challenge, a new country, and new roads for the Quigley brothers.

This event attracts some of the biggest names in rallying, including rally legend Sébastien Loeb, so we knew the competition would be fierce.

The rally was run over two days, and the boys got off to a strong start, sitting comfortably inside the top 20. As they settled into the event, the pace continued to improve, with stage times consistently inside the top 15.

Unfortunately, rallying can be a cruel sport. A puncture on the longest stage forced the crew to stop and change a wheel, costing valuable minutes.

Despite the setback, the boys brought the car home in 23rd overall. Without the puncture, they would have been on course for 13th – but that’s rallying!

Last weekend, Sean and Colin Quigley took on the challenging Rally Wervik in Belgium.

Often regarded as a key shakedown event ahead of Ypres Rally, the entry list was packed with talent, including Jos Verstappen and Freddy Loix, making for a highly competitive weekend.

The rally presented a completely new challenge for Sean, with fast stages, deep cuts, and a level of commitment unlike anything he had experienced before. An early spin on SS1 dented confidence initially, but as the event progressed and the crew gained valuable kilometres and experience, their pace and confidence continued to improve.

By the finish, Sean and Colin secured an excellent result:
🏁 2nd FIRC Crew
🏁 1st British Crew
🏁 22nd Overall

A fantastic achievement against strong international competition and, most importantly, a hugely valuable learning experience for the team.
